中国住房和城乡建设部网站建造师,开发简单小程序公司,浏览器网站设置在哪里,免费seo关键词优化排名一般情况下#xff0c;使用pip命令安装即可#xff1a;[rootdthost27 ~]# pip install mysql-python但是在实际工作环境中#xff0c;往往会安装失败#xff0c;这是因为系统缺少mysql的相关依赖组件。所以必须先安装mysql-devel类的包#xff0c;而且必须要对应好mysql客…一般情况下使用pip命令安装即可[rootdthost27 ~]# pip install mysql-python但是在实际工作环境中往往会安装失败这是因为系统缺少mysql的相关依赖组件。所以必须先安装mysql-devel类的包而且必须要对应好mysql客户端的版本即要安装好[rootdthost27 ~]#rpm -ivhmysql-community-libs-5.7.23-1.el6.x86_64.rpmmysql-community-client-5.7.23-1.el6.x86_64.rpmmysql-community-common-5.7.23-1.el6.x86_64.rpmmysql-community-devel-5.7.23-1.el6.x86_64.rpm这里需要各位注意的是要根据自身系统选择正确版本的mysql比如这里的“5.7.23-1.el6.x86_64”即为我这边mysql服务器的版本以及linux系统的对应版本。安装成功后进入mysql环境直接import看看python import MySQLdbpython没有报错添加依赖包成功补充安装MYSQL-PYTHON包报错mysql_config not found解决办法安装MYSQL-PYTHON包报错EnvironmentError: mysql_config not found问题要如何来解决呢今天我们就一起来看看这个问题的解决办法具体操作如下所示。使用pip install MySQL-python的方式安装遇到以下几个问题1.提示错误EnvironmentError: mysql_config not found这是因为本机是Mac OSX系统并且装的MySQL是MAMP集成环境中的实际上mysql_config这个文件是存在的但是默认包里面的路径有问题可以重新装一个MySQL到系统默认位置不过既然已经有了MySQL不想重复装。解决办法是从pypi官网下载一个MySQL-python包然后修改其中的setup_posix.py文件找到定义mysql_config路径的地方如修改为/Applications/MAMP/Library/bin/mysql_config具体路径根据情况而定。可以搜索mysql_config如果找到了就以那个路径为准这是MAMP下Mysql_config文件的位置。然后进入到包目录使用python setup.py install命令开始安装。2.上面的错误解决了又提示错误fatal error: ‘my_config.h file not found这是因为MAMP自带的MySQL不包含dev headers使用1.Run in Terminal app:ruby -e $(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install) /dev/null 2 /dev/null等待完成2.Run:brew install mysql-connector-c安装。安装完成后再回到Python重新安装MySQL-python包就可以了。以上为个人经验希望能给大家一个参考也希望大家多多支持免费资源网。如有错误或未考虑完全的地方望不吝赐教。